Where was Alexander Graham Bell buried?

Quote from the related link below: "Dr. Alexander Graham Bell was buried atop Beinn Bhreagh mountain, on his estate where he had resided increasingly for the last 35 years of his life, overlooking Bras d'Or Lake. "

Who said to forgive is divine?

Alexander Pope is credited with the phrase "To err is human, to forgive divine" in his poem An Essay on Criticism.


What was Alexander Graham Bell's famous quote?

Concentrate all your thoughts on the task at hand. The sun's rays do not burn until brought to a focus.
